smudges

[/smʌdʒɪz/]
noun/verbpl: smudges
manchas/borrões
1. Marks or stains that are blurred or smeared, typically made by rubbing or pressing something dirty against a surface
There are smudges on the window glass.
Há manchas de graxa no vidro da janela.
2. Third person singular or plural form of the verb 'to smudge': to mark or blur with smudges
She smudges the charcoal with her finger to create a shadow effect.
Ela borra o carvão com o dedo para criar um efeito de sombra.
3. A blurry or indistinct mark or image
The photograph only shows a smudge where the face should be.
A fotografia mostra apenas um borrão onde deveria estar o rosto.
